Description

The measured data of enthalpy, hemispherical total and normal spectral emissivities, and electrical resistivity of tantalum at temperatures from 1000 to 3230 K were reported, along with their corresponding expanded uncertainties except for that of the spectral emissivity.

Steps to reproduce

All data were determined by mulit-stepwise pulse calorimetry, which is a combined dynamic and static calorimetric method. The details of this method is described in the paper submitted to Thermochimica Acta.
